Transaction f6a63abaec46fcbfa37396b7df3f59566205871dfbb23e0c01c93391b1a84e09

2 Input
2 Outputs
  • f6a63abaec46fcbfa37396b7df3f59566205871dfbb23e0c01c93391b1a84e09:0
  • value  106900
    address  38YkbFM7XeNTCwuzeFC39spETz64wFLVhe
  • f6a63abaec46fcbfa37396b7df3f59566205871dfbb23e0c01c93391b1a84e09:1
  • value  171255
    address  15n1b87fKpDLhKHZKuPcX9RtEbTwzsXvfK